Output 75f7a4543cdc815cc97e9751e648ee0474824b63eb686660927e0a5291368f5b:0

value
49627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50af39286da038e8578c8c43a14ce61d8b409db2 OP_EQUAL
address
393dtcidwUKdAzxg5WBsnYpcZqNuHC67FQ
transaction
75f7a4543cdc815cc97e9751e648ee0474824b63eb686660927e0a5291368f5b
spent
true